Checking the Video Cables and Connections
The first step in troubleshooting the issue is to check the video cables and connections. Ensure that the video cables are securely connected to both the computer and the monitor. Try swapping the video cables or using a different video output port on your computer to rule out any issues with the cables or ports.
Configuring the Display Settings
If the video cables and connections are secure, the next step is to configure the display settings. To do this, follow these steps:
Press the Windows key + P to open the Projector window
Select the desired display mode (e.g., Extend, Duplicate, or Show only on 1)
Click on the Detect button to detect the additional monitor

Updating the Graphics Drivers
Outdated or corrupted graphics drivers can cause issues with multiple monitor setups. Updating the graphics drivers can often resolve the issue. To update the graphics drivers, follow these steps:
Open the Device Manager
Expand the Display Adapters section
Right-click on the graphics driver and select Update driver
Follow the prompts to search for and install updated drivers
Using the Device Manager to Troubleshoot the Issue
The Device Manager can be a useful tool for troubleshooting issues with multiple monitor setups. To use the Device Manager, follow these steps:
Open the Device Manager
Expand the Display Adapters section
Look for any error messages or warnings related to the graphics driver
Disable and re-enable the graphics driver to reset it

How do I troubleshoot display issues with multiple monitors on a Windows computer?
To troubleshoot display issues on a Windows computer with multiple monitors, start by checking the display settings. Press the Windows key + P to open the Projector window, and select the appropriate display option, such as PC screen only, Duplicate, Extend, or Second screen only. Ensure that the multiple display option is enabled and that the secondary monitor is selected as an extended desktop or duplicate display. If the issue persists, try updating the graphics drivers to the latest version. You can do this by going to the Device Manager, expanding the Display Adapters section, right-clicking on the graphics driver, and selecting Update driver.
If updating the graphics drivers doesn’t resolve the issue, you can try resetting the display settings to their default values. To do this, go to the Display settings, click on the Multiple displays dropdown menu, and select the default settings. You can also try disconnecting the secondary monitor, restarting the computer, and then reconnecting the monitor. This can sometimes resolve issues related to driver conflicts or display settings. Additionally, ensure that the Windows operating system is up-to-date, as newer updates may include fixes for display-related issues. By following these steps, you can troubleshoot and potentially resolve display issues with multiple monitors on your Windows computer.
What is the purpose of the Display Settings dialog box in Windows, and how can I access it?
The Display Settings dialog box in Windows provides a centralized location for configuring display settings, including multiple monitor setups. From this dialog box, you can adjust the display orientation, resolution, and refresh rate, as well as configure the multiple display options. To access the Display Settings dialog box, right-click on an empty area of the desktop and select Display settings. Alternatively, you can search for “Display settings” in the Start menu and select the corresponding result. The Display Settings dialog box will appear, allowing you to configure the display settings to your preferences.
The Display Settings dialog box is divided into several sections, including Display, Multiple displays, and Advanced display settings. The Display section allows you to adjust the display orientation, resolution, and refresh rate, while the Multiple displays section enables you to configure the multiple display options, such as extending the desktop or duplicating the display. The Advanced display settings section provides more detailed options, including the ability to adjust the color calibration and reset the display settings to their default values. By accessing the Display Settings dialog box, you can fine-tune your display settings to optimize your computing experience.
Can I connect multiple monitors to a laptop, and what are the limitations?
Yes, you can connect multiple monitors to a laptop, but there are some limitations to consider. The number of monitors you can connect depends on the laptop’s graphics card and the available ports. Most modern laptops have at least one HDMI port, one DisplayPort, and one USB-C port, which can be used to connect external monitors. However, the graphics card may not be able to support more than two external monitors, and the available ports may limit the number of monitors you can connect. Additionally, some laptops may have specific requirements, such as requiring a docking station or a USB-C hub to connect multiple monitors.
To connect multiple monitors to a laptop, start by checking the available ports and the graphics card’s capabilities. If your laptop has a USB-C port, you can use a USB-C hub to connect multiple monitors using DisplayPort or HDMI. Alternatively, you can use a docking station to connect multiple monitors, as well as other peripherals, such as keyboards and mice. When connecting multiple monitors, ensure that the laptop’s graphics card can handle the increased load, and adjust the display settings accordingly. It’s also essential to check for any software or driver updates that may be required to support multiple monitors. By understanding the limitations and capabilities of your laptop, you can successfully connect multiple monitors and enhance your productivity.
